WebApr 6, 2024 · Diagonal Relationship of Lithium with Magnesium. (1) Both have almost similar electronegativities. (2) Both Li and Mg are quite hard. They are harder and lighter than other elements in their respective groups. (3) Both LiOH and Mg (OH)2 are weak bases. (4) Both form ionic nitrides when heated in atmosphere of Nitrogen. WebJan 29, 2024 · Due to diagonal relationship, Be and Al show following similarities in their properties: a. Nature of bonding: Both Be and Al have tendency to form covalent chlorides. e.g. b. Lewis acids: BeCl2 and AlCl3 act as Lewis acids. c. Solubility in organic solvents: BeCl2 and AlCl3 are soluble in organic solvents. d.
